An all-boarding school that has continued since ancient times. This is a place where boys and girls who possess the ability to summon and wield their unique swords from their palms, known as 'Shishin' (Heart Swords), gather. A powerful 'Kekkai' (barrier) is constantly deployed within the school grounds, preventing serious injuries from combat training. Here, emphasis is placed not only on the techniques of wielding the Shishin but also on fostering the ethics necessary to use that power correctly. Within the solemn discipline, the passion of the youth and the vitality of their growth quietly fill the air.
In summer and winter, there are sword fighting tournaments called 'Gozen Jiai' (Imperial Audience Matches). The name 'Gozen' is a remnant of ancient times, and it's not that a lord actually comes to watch. It's a tournament for participating students, and many students use their success in this competition as motivation for their daily training.
After the 'Gozen Jiai', the 'Tenrin Sai' (Heavenly Ring Festival) is held. Classes are suspended for several days, and many stalls are set up on the school grounds for enjoyment. At night, it's illuminated by lanterns and other lights, creating a fantastical scene. Lookout points located throughout the school buildings and the shade of large trees are popular spots for confessions.
